Another taxi question

Hey everyone,

Debating on whether to take the depalm tour bus (which is what we did last time we were in Aruba and thought it went fine) or to take a taxi. Just wondering if anyone knows how long it takes to get from the airport to amsterdam manor?

by taxi from airport to amsterdam manor without traffic= 12+ minutes
with traffic, could be 30 minutes.
DePalm, 20 + minutes without traffic
DePalm 35+ minutes with traffic
these are guesstimates and are pretty conservative

Amsterdam Manor is at least the 3rd stop DePalm

There's a five person limit at this time (they're hoping to get the maximum number increased), so you should be good. Many of the vehicles are suv's or mini vans, so you won't have any problems finding a taxi.

We had five a couple of years ago, and didn't have any problems even with luggage. This year, we had six, and had to hire 2 taxi's due to the rules.

Edit: We each had a carry-on suitcase, personal item (backpack or smaller) and one larger suitcase that was checked, when we had five for one taxi.
